FTP Setup Guide for GoDaddy, Bluehost, and Other Hosts

Complete FTP Setup Guide

Setting up FTP access is your gateway to full website control. This guide covers the most popular hosting providers.

GoDaddy FTP Setup

  • . Log into GoDaddy
  • 2. Navigate to My Products

    3. Find your hosting and click Manage

    4. Access cPanel or FTP settings

    5. Create or view FTP accounts

    6. Note your host, username, password, and port

    Bluehost FTP Setup

  • . Log into Bluehost
  • 2. Go to Advanced (cPanel)

    3. Find Files section

    4. Click FTP Accounts

    5. Create new account or use existing

    6. Record credentials

    HostGator FTP Setup

  • . Log into HostGator
  • 2. Access cPanel

    3. Navigate to Files > FTP Accounts

    4. Create or manage accounts

    5. Save your credentials

    SiteGround FTP Setup

  • . Log into SiteGround
  • 2. Go to Site Tools

    3. Select Devs > FTP Accounts

    4. Create account if needed

    5. Copy credentials

    Universal Tips

  • Always use SFTP when available (port 22)
  • Create dedicated FTP users for security
  • Store passwords securely
  • Test connection before starting work
